MST Method

1. Select a starting node


2. Select the node closest to the starting node


3. Select the closest node not presently in the spanning tree


4. Repeat step 3 until all nodes are connected to the spanning tree

What is a graph?

Nodes and arcs/edges


Eg. Rail network

What is a network?

A graph with arcs/edges that values "weights"


Eg. National grids, telecommunication, social networks

What is a MST

The least number of arcs that is necessary to reach all nodes and minimises total weight.
